Transaction 83aa84d01c42f00f356c670410fc92a88497d2c8508bc470b4ec96a92d992558
1 Input
1 Output
-
83aa84d01c42f00f356c670410fc92a88497d2c8508bc470b4ec96a92d992558:0
- value
- 24814
- script pubkey
- OP_0 OP_PUSHBYTES_32 1c4974c1f757f3ea687cb0dd5fae6a5214c7f7f04f02de8ab08e3124da787dd9
- address
- bc1qr3yhfs0h2le756rukrw4ltn22g2v0alsfupdaz4s3ccjfknc0hvsp8samy